Intel® RAID Controller SRCSAS18E
Physical drives going offline when using J5 connector

Symptom:
Physical drives may go offline intermittently if J5 connector is used for connecting SES cable to hot-swap enclosure

Cause:
J5 connector implements SAF-TE enclosure management protocol. Currently this implementation does not work properly with Intel hot-swap enclosures resulting in intermittent drive failures.

Solution:
Use J18 connector instead of J5 connector. J18 implements SES2 enclosure management protocol.

This applies to:
Intel® RAID Controller SRCSAS18E
